Unfinished Business: Dutch Abstracts, Kunstverein Medienturm Graz, Austria

    Thomas Wildner, certain improbability, 1 move, 59 steps, 2006 May 9 — July 5, 2008 Kunstverein Medienturm in Graz presents the group show UNFINISHED BUSINESS – DUTCH ABSTRACTS. The exhibition with Dutch-based artists, working in the field of non-objective /abstract art, features as a second part of a duo exhibition, the first part being AUSTRIAN ABSTRACTS in Amsterdam, 2006.
